Ingredients

List of Ingredients

- 8 oz pasta of choice (penne or rigatoni recommended)

- 1 lb spicy turkey sausage, removed from casings

- 1 tablespoon olive oil

- 1 small onion, diced

- 3 cloves garlic, minced

- 1 red bell pepper, diced

- 1 zucchini, sliced

- 1 can (14 oz) crushed tomatoes

- 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es (adjust to taste)

-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ning

- Salt and pepper to taste

- Fresh basil leaves for garnish

- Grated Parmesan cheese for serving

Step-by-Step Instructions

Cooking the Pasta

First, grab a large pot. Fill it with water and add salt. Bring the water to a boil. Once boiling, add 8 ounces of pasta. I like penne or rigatoni for this dish. Cook the pasta according to the package instructions. Aim for al dente, which means it should be firm yet tender. This usually takes about 8-10 minutes. When done, drain the pasta and set it aside.

Sautéing the Spicy Turkey Sausage

Next, take a large skillet and place it on medium-high heat. Pour in 1 tablespoon of olive oil and let it heat up. Then, remove the casing from 1 pound of spicy turkey sausage. Add the sausage to the hot skillet. Use a spoon to break it apart as it cooks. Brown the sausage for about 5-7 minutes. Make sure it is cooked through and no longer pink.

Adding Vegetables and Simmering

Now it’s time to add flavor. Toss in 1 small diced onion and 3 minced garlic cloves. Then, add 1 diced red bell pepper and 1 sliced zucchini. Stir everything together and sauté for about 4-5 minutes. You want the vegetables to soften but not lose their color. Next, pour in 1 can of crushed tomatoes. Add 1 teaspoon of red pepper flakes, 1 teaspoon of Italian seasoning, and salt and pepper to taste. Stir well and let it simmer for another 5 minutes. This allows all the flavors to mix perfectly.

How to Achieve Perfectly Cooked Pasta

To cook pasta just right, always use plenty of water. A large pot helps the pasta move freely. Add salt to the water for flavor. Follow the time on the package for best results. Check the pasta a minute before the time is up. It should feel firm but not hard. This is called al dente. After cooking, drain the pasta right away. You can save a bit of the pasta water for later.

Best Techniques for Sautéing Sausage

When sautéing spicy turkey sausage, use a large skillet. Heat the skillet before adding olive oil. This helps the sausage brown well. Break the sausage into small pieces while cooking. Stir it often to cook evenly. Look for a nice brown color to know it’s ready. This will take about 5 to 7 minutes.

Storage Info

Tips for Storing Leftovers

Store any leftover spicy turkey sausage pasta in an airtight container. Make sure to cool it to room temperature first. This will help keep it fresh. You can keep it in the fridge for up to three days. If you want to enjoy it later, consider freezing it instead.

Reheating Instructions

To reheat, use a microwave or a skillet. If using a microwave, place the pasta in a bowl. Add a splash of water to keep it moist. Heat it for about one to two minutes. Stir halfway through to ensure even heating. If using a skillet, add a little olive oil and heat over medium. Stir until hot.

Freezing the Dish: What You Need to Know

You can freeze spicy turkey sausage pasta for up to three months. First, let it cool completely. Then, place it in a freezer-safe container or bag. Remove as much air as possible to avoid freezer burn. When ready to eat, thaw it in the fridge overnight before reheating. This will help maintain its flavor and texture.

Ingredients

Instructions

  1. 1

    In a large pot, bring salted water to a boil. Add the pasta and cook according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.

  2. 2

    In a large skillet over medium-high heat, add olive oil. Once hot, add the spicy turkey sausage, breaking it up with a spoon. Cook until browned and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es.

  3. 3

    Stir in the diced onion, minced garlic, red bell pepper, and zucchini to the skillet. Sauté for about 4-5 minutes until the vegetables soften.

  4. 4

    Pour in the crushed tomatoes, red pepper flakes,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Stir to combine and let it simmer for another 5 minutes, allowing flavors to meld.

  5. 5

    Add the drained pasta to the skillet, tossing everything together until well mixed. If the mixture seems too dry, you can add a splash of pasta water.

  6. 6

    Dish out the pasta into bowls, garnishing with fresh basil leaves and a generous sprinkle of grated Parmesan cheese.
